A
Solid
Opening!
According
to
trade
analyst
LM
Kaushik,
Kadaikutty
Singam
has
managed
to
collect
Rs
95
Lakh
at
the
Chennai
box
office
in
two
days.
Most
industry
trackers
are
of
the
opinion
that
this
is
a
reasonably
good
start
and
indicates
that
the
film
has
clicked
with
the
fans.
Will
Kadaikutty
Singam
Be
Able
To
Beat
Theeran
Adigaram
Ondru?
Theeran
Adigaram
Ondru
had
collected
around
Rs
1.79
Crore
at
the
Chennai
BO
over
the
opening
weekend.
Early
trends
indicate
that
Kadaikutty
Singam
might
outperform
the
Vinoth
directorial
and
give
Karthi's
fans
a
reason
to
rejoice.
